CHESTER, Pa. - The Widener University esports team continued a strong season in Rocket League as the Pride advanced to the quarterfinals of the NACE Rocket League Fall Cup with a pair of wins on Tuesday evening.Â
The Pride was represented by
Tom "tommyE44" Eisenhower,
Jack "therm" Merhar, and
Kyle "Scoob" Samber.
Playing a pair of best-of-five series, Widener dispatched Boise State 3-1 in its opening match. Later in the evening, the Blue and Gold took down Shenandoah, 3-1.Â
Widener returns to action in the NACE Fall Cup on Tuesday, November 10 when it battles the University of Missouri Gold squad at 8:00 p.m. The winner of that match will take on the winner between St. Clair and Northwood in the semifinals at 9:15 p.m.
